11/25/2023 – Ukrainian Teens Win Peace Prize

From: Ukraine.ua – Three Ukrainian teenage girls were awarded the 2023 International Children’s Peace Prize in London for developing apps for refugee children.

Before the full-scale war, Sofia Tereshchenko, 18, Anastasiia Feskova, 17, and Anastasiia Demchenko, 17, already worked together on a mobile app. But after February 24, 2022, they focused their project on helping children who were forced to flee across the border without their parents.

The girls want to extend their apps to all refugee children to help them feel safe, integrate into a new country, and facilitate communication between refugee and host community children.

The International Children’s Peace Prize was launched in 2005. Among its winners are Greta Thunberg and Malala Yousafzai.
